Responsibilities
Operational & Infusion Workflow Support
Support end-to-end infusion workflows, including referral intake, scheduling coordination, benefits verification, prior authorization support, and documentation tracking
Serve as an operational liaison between pharmacy operations, nursing teams, reimbursement, and account management to ensure seamless execution of infusion services
Monitor infusion work queues and assist with issue resolution to prevent delays in patient access to therapy
Identify gaps, inefficiencies, or bottlenecks in infusion workflows and recommend process improvements
Data Analysis & Reporting
Track and analyze infusion-related metrics, including referral volumes, turnaround times, payer trends, site-of-care utilization, and operational performance
Develop and maintain routine and ad hoc reports to support leadership, account management, and client reporting needs
Assist with data validation and accuracy across infusion systems, dashboards, and reporting tools
Support performance assessments, operational reviews, and client-facing analytics as needed
Payer & Reimbursement Support
Assist with benefits investigation and authorization workflows for infusion therapies, working closely with reimbursement teams
Support payer-related inquiries, denials tracking, and escalation workflows
Help identify trends related to payer requirements, authorization timelines, and reimbursement challenges
Process Improvement & Compliance Support
Participate in process improvement initiatives to enhance infusion efficiency, compliance, and scalability
Support documentation and data needs related to audits, performance assessments, RFIs, and plans of correction
Assist in maintaining alignment with internal policies, SOPs, and regulatory requirements impacting infusion services
Collaboration & Communication
Partner with pharmacists, nurses, account managers, and leadership to support operational and strategic infusion initiatives
Communicate clearly and professionally with internal stakeholders regarding infusion status, issues, and trends
Provide operational insights and recommendations to support decision-making and service optimization
